$ cat test_json.go
package main

import (
	"github.com/kataras/iris"
)

func main() {

	// render JSON
	iris.Get("/hi_json", func(c *iris.Context) {
		c.JSON(iris.StatusOK, iris.Map{
			"Name":  "Iris",
			"Born":  "13 March 2016",
			"Stars": 2440,
		})
	})
	iris.Listen(":8080")
}

$ cat test_party.go
package main

import (
	"github.com/kataras/iris"
	"github.com/kataras/iris/middleware/logger"
)

func main() {
	// logger middleware
	log := logger.New(iris.Logger)

	// group routes by path prefix and middleware sharing
	group := iris.Party("/users", log)
	{
		group.Get("/", func(c *iris.Context) {
			// return all users or render a template
		})

		group.Get("/:userID", func(c *iris.Context) {
			// return a user with ID `c.Param("userID")`
		})

		group.Delete("/:userID", func(c *iris.Context) {
			//delete a user with ID `c.Param("userID")`
		})
	}

	// using static subdomains
	subdomain := iris.Party("account.", log, myAuthMiddleware).Layout("layouts/subdomain.html")
	{
		subdomain.Get("/", func(c *iris.Context) {
			// render a template with a context of {username: "myusername"}
			c.Render("account/index.html", iris.Map{ // we can also use a struct
				"username": c.Session().GetString("username"),
			})
		})

		subdomain.Post("/edit", func(c *iris.Context) {
			//...
		})
	}

	// using dynamic subdomains
	dynamicSub := iris.Party("*.")
	{
		// middleware on route, called before the final handler
		dynamicSub.Get("/", log, func(c *iris.Context) {
			c.Write("Hello from subdomain: %s", c.Subdomain())
		})
	}

	iris.Listen(":8080")
}

// using high level sessions inside a custom middleware
func myAuthMiddleware(c *iris.Context) {
	s := c.Session()

	if s.GetString("username") == "myusername" && s.GetString("password") == "mypassword" {
		c.Next()
	} else {
		c.EmitError(iris.StatusUnauthorized)
	}
}

Installation

The only requirement is Go 1.6

$ go get -u github.com/kataras/iris/iris

Features

  • Focus on high performance
  • Robust routing & static, wildcard subdomains
  • View system supporting 5+ template engines
  • Highly scalable Websocket API with custom events
  • Sessions support with GC, memory & redis providers
  • Middlewares & Plugins were never be easier
  • Full REST API
  • Custom HTTP Errors
  • Typescript compiler + Browser editor
  • Content negotiation & streaming
  • Transport Layer Security
  • Reload on source code changes

Philosophy

The Iris philosophy is to provide robust tooling for HTTP, making it a great solution for single page applications, web sites, hybrids, or public HTTP APIs.

Iris does not force you to use any specific ORM or template engine. With support for the most used template engines, you can quickly craft the perfect application.
